Flowerbed edging installation involves adding a defined border around garden beds to create a clean, organized appearance. This service typically includes selecting the appropriate edging material, preparing the ground, and installing the border to ensure it stays in place over time. Whether using stone, plastic, metal, or other materials, professional contractors focus on creating a durable and visually appealing separation between flowerbeds and lawn areas. Proper installation helps prevent soil from spilling into the grass and keeps mulch or decorative stones contained within the bed, making garden maintenance easier and more efficient.

This service addresses several common landscaping problems. Over time, flowerbeds can become overgrown or lose their shape, leading to a messy or unkempt look. Edging helps define the space clearly, preventing grass or weeds from encroaching into flowerbeds. It also reduces the need for frequent trimming or weed removal along the edges, saving homeowners time and effort. Additionally, well-installed edging can protect garden beds from erosion during heavy rain or watering, maintaining the integrity of the bed’s structure and keeping plants healthy.

The overview below groups typical Flowerbed Edging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Boise, ID.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Projects - Typical costs for installing flowerbed edging on small, straightforward areas range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, covering simple garden borders or small flowerbeds. Less complex projects tend to stay within these lower to mid-range estimates.

Mid-Size Installations - Larger flowerbed edging projects, such as wrapping around multiple garden beds or extending along longer borders, generally cost between $600 and $1,500. These are common for homeowners seeking to enhance larger sections of their yard with local contractors handling the work.

Complex or Custom Designs - Custom or intricate edging, including decorative materials or unique layouts, can range from $1,500 to $3,000. Projects in this tier are less frequent but offer more design flexibility and detail, often involving specialized materials or features.

Full Replacement or Large-Scale Jobs - Extensive flowerbed edging, such as replacing old borders across a sizable landscape or multiple areas, can reach $3,000 to $5,000 or more. These larger, more complex projects are less common but handled by experienced local service providers for significant landscaping upgrades.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of installing flowerbed edging? Installing flowerbed edging helps define garden borders, prevents soil erosion, and keeps mulch and plants contained, creating a neat and organized appearance.

What types of materials are commonly used for flowerbed edging? Common materials include brick, stone, metal, plastic, and wood, each offering different styles and durability levels to suit various landscape designs.

How can local contractors assist with flowerbed edging installation? Local service providers can help select appropriate materials, prepare the site, and professionally install the edging to ensure a clean and lasting result.

Is flowerbed edging suitable for all garden types? Yes, flowerbed edging can be adapted for different garden styles and sizes, providing a functional and aesthetic boundary for flowerbeds and landscaped areas.

What maintenance is required for installed flowerbed edging? Maintenance typically involves occasional cleaning, checking for damage, and repairing or replacing sections as needed to keep the edging looking its best.
